Warning Signs You Need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ent long-term damage to your property. Look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your property, it may be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, call our team to investigate and address the issue before it’s too late.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p, buckle, or even collapse. If you notice any of these issues, it’s essential to address the problem quickly to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Stains
Water damage can cause discoloration or staining on walls, ceilings, and floors. If you notice any unusual marks or discoloration,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and address it before it spreads.
Water Stains on Ceilings
Water stains on ceilings are a clear sign of water damage. Don’t ignore them, call our team to investigate and address the issue before it’s too late.
Leaks Under Appliances
Leaks under appliances, such as dishwashers, refrigerators, and washing machines, can cause significant water damage. Check your appliances regularly to prevent leaks and ensure they’re properly installed and maintained.
Visible Water Damage on Walls
Visible water damage on walls, such as peeling paint, warping, or buckling, is a clear sign of a more significant issue. Call our team to investigate and address the problem before it’s too late.
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under sink |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with some basic plumbing knowledge and tools. |
| Large water stain on ceiling | No | Yes | It’s a sign of a more significant issue that needs professional attention to prevent further damage. |
| Musty odor in property | No | Yes | It may show water damage or mold growth that needs professional investigation and remediation. |
| Water damage from storm | No | Yes | It’s a complex issue that needs specialized equipment and expertise to address properly. |
| Leak under dishwasher |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with some basic plumbing knowledge and tools. |
| War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| It’s a sign of water damage that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and costly repairs. |

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ration Cost In Lawrenceville, GA
The cost of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lawrenceville, GA. These estimates are based on typical scenarios and may not reflect the actual c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of drying process.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, and level of contamination. |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s. |
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Complexity of damage, size of affected area, and duration of inspection. |
| Equipment Rental and Supplies | $500 – $2,000 | Duration of project, type of equipment needed, and frequency of supplies. |
| Project Management and Coordination |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of project, number of stakeholders, and duration of project. |

What is the best way to prevent water damage in my multi-family property?
Regular maintenance, inspections, and prompt repairs can help prevent water damage. Make sure to check your plumbing, appliances, and roof regularly for signs of wear and tear. Also, consider installing a sump pump and backup power source to protect against flooding. Our team can help you develop a customized maintenance plan to keep your property safe and secure.
